Growth vs value investing.

Value investing has been advocated by investors as far back as Benjamin Graham and David Dodd in the 1930s. 9 Fama and French show that there have been many prolonged periods of Value outperformance over the past century and Value has outperformed Growth cumulatively over this time, despite strong headwinds for over a decade (Exhibit 14).

In many cases, successful investing means staying ahead of the curve — a tactic that can help you scoop up stocks th...Value and growth are essentially Wall Street labels to describe low growth and high growth companies. Value investing, the Buffett or Graham strategy, is the idea of buying a company at a discount to its economic value. If you can consistently buy a dollar worth of company stock for fifty cents, outperformance is inevitable.

With the digitization of the economy being accelerated due to the Internet, the COVID-19 pandemic and the rise of AI, investors …Growth vs. Value Investing. Growth and value are the two basic styles when choosing stocks or stock mutual fund investments. Growth investors look for fast-growing companies they expect to continue to grow at above-average rates. These are often, but not always, young companies.
